Research Project: Nutritional Quality and Micronutrient Bioavailability of Foods

Location: Plant, Soil and Nutrition Research

Project Number: 8062-10700-001-002-A
Project Type: Cooperative Agreement

Start Date: Jul 1, 2021
End Date: Jun 30, 2024

Objective:
Nutrients such as iron, zinc, carotenoids, folate and polyphenols are essential to human health. Therefore, the overall objective is to conduct research on content, quality and bioavailability of these nutrients in staple foods and food products. To do so, this work will involve interaction with plant breeders, nutritionists and food scientists. Sub-objectives of the project will include identification and development of plant varieties with enhanced nutritional quality for the above nutrients; development of analytical tools, evaluation of food processing and formulation for nutritional quality; and characterization of the nutritional benefits of the enhanced foods in human diets and food systems.

Approach:
A combination of in vitro and analytical techniques will be coupled with animal feeding trials to determine nutrient content and bioavailability.
